Egg Roll Soup with a Flavorful Asian Twist Recipe

This Egg Roll Soup with a Flavorful Asian Twist is a comforting and delicious bowl inspired by classic egg rolls. Combining ground pork or chicken, fresh vegetables, and savory seasonings, this soup offers a nutritious, easy-to-make meal perfect for a cozy lunch or dinner. Enhanced with ginger, garlic, and soy sauce, it delivers authentic Asian flavors with a healthy and light broth base.

Ingredients

Scale

Soup Ingredients

  • 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
  • 1/2 lb ground pork (or ground chicken)
  • 1 small onion,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on grated fresh ginger
  • 2 cups shredded cabbage
  • 1/2 cup shredded carrots
  • 3 cups chicken broth
  • 1 tablespoon so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on sesame oil
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)

Garnish

  • 2 green onions, sliced
  • 1 boiled egg, halved (optional)

Instructions

  1. Brown the Meat: In a large pot, heat 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il over medium heat. Add the ground pork or chicken and cook until browned, breaking it up with a spoon to ensure even cooking.
  2. Sauté Aromatics: Add the diced onion, minced garlic, and grated fresh ginger to the pot. Sauté for 2-3 minutes until the onion softens and the mixture becomes fragrant.
  3. Add Vegetables: Stir in the shredded cabbage and shredded carrots, cooking for an additional 2 minutes so the vegetables begin to soften but maintain some texture.
  4. Add Broth and Seasonings: Pour in the chicken broth along with soy sauce, rice vinegar, sesame oil, and ground black pepper. Stir well to combine all ingredients.
  5. Simmer the Soup: Bring the mixture to a simmer over medium heat. Optionally, add red pepper flakes for heat. Let the soup simmer gently for 10-15 minutes until the vegetables are tender and all flavors meld together.
  6. Serve and Garnish: Ladle the hot soup into bowls. Garnish with sliced green onions and optional boiled egg halves for an added protein and presentation boost.

Notes

  • You can substitute ground chicken or turkey for pork as a leaner protein option.
  • For a vegetarian version, replace ground meat with tofu and use vegetable broth instead.
  • Adjust red pepper flakes according to your preferred spice level or omit completely.
  • Leftover soup stores well in the refrigerator for up to 3 days and can be reheated gently on the stovetop.
  • Adding a dash of toasted sesame seeds or a drizzle of chili oil before serving adds extra flavor depth.
